5.20.3 IM Host Account page

The System Common Settings window has the IM Host Account page, which is displayed when JP1/IM - View is connected to the Windows version of JP1/IM - Manager. This page is not displayed when the IM configuration management viewer is connected to the UNIX version of JP1/IM - Manager. When you change the settings of the IM Host Account page, restart the JP1/IM - Manager service.

The following figure shows an example of the IM Host Account page.

Figure 5‒38: Example of the IM Host Account page

[Figure]

The following describes the items displayed on the IM Host Account page.

User name

Specify the user account that starts the collection process for remote monitoring. Specify a user who has Administrator permission on the host where JP1/IM - Manager is installed. Alphabetic characters are not case sensitive. The user name can use alphanumeric characters and symbols other than control characters. A character string having from 0 through 255 bytes can be specified. The previously specified user name is used as the initial value. If no user name has previously been specified, a blank is displayed.

This item cannot be omitted if there are entries in other text boxes on the page.

For cautionary notes that relate to the IM host account in the system common settings, see 8.6.9(2) Precautions for the IM host account of the System Common Settings in the JP1/Integrated Management 3 - Manager Overview and System Design Guide.

Password

This text box specifies the password. Alphabetic characters are case sensitive. The password can use alphanumeric characters and symbols other than control characters. A character string having from 0 through 255 bytes can be specified. The previously specified password is used as the initial value, but the characters are masked by asterisks (*). If no password has previously been specified, a blank is displayed.

This item cannot be omitted if there are entries in text boxes other than User name.

Password confirmation

This text box specifies the password again for confirmation. The characters that can be used, the maximum length, and the default value are the same as those for the Password text box.

Domain name

This text box specifies the domain name. Alphabetic characters are not case sensitive. The domain name can use alphanumeric characters and symbols other than control characters. A character string having from 0 through 255 bytes can be specified. The previously specified domain name is used as the initial value. If no domain name has previously been specified, a blank is displayed.
